Granite Intrusion
The penetration of molten granite into pre-existing rocks in the Earth's crust, cooling and solidifying below the surface.
Cross-Cutting Relations
A geological principle stating that rocks disrupted or penetrated by an igneous intrusion or fault are older than the intrusion or fault itself.
Superposition
A principle in geology that states in an undeformed sequence of sedimentary rocks, each layer is older than the one above.
Facies Change
A change in the characteristics of rock layers indicating a change in environment of deposition, such as from marine to terrestrial.
